Web15 Nov 2024 · Firstly, use a spirit level placed on the edge of stove to check which way your stove tilts. Adjust the feet accordingly to level the stove, then place the spirit level on the stove again to check the adjustment. Once the bubble inside the spirit level stays in the middle, the cooker should be level and won’t tilt any further. Web5 Nov 2024 · Here is an easy and safe way to clean an induction stovetop: Combine equal amounts of baking soda and vinegar in a spray bottle. Spray the solution and wait 15-20 mins. Wipe the stovetop clean. Repeat if necessary. Remove hard food residue using a scraper gently at a 30-degree angle.

WebRaised beds don’t need much more maintenance than ground-level beds, but there are a few things to look out for. Watering Your Bed. Because they have better drainage, in dry and hot conditions raised beds can dry out more easily than other areas of your garden.
